What is the main benefit of using UI components in application development?

Prepare for the San Diego UI Builder Fundamentals Exam with engaging flashcards and multiple-choice questions featuring detailed hints and explanations. Get ahead in your certification!

Multiple Choice

What is the main benefit of using UI components in application development?

Explanation:
The primary benefit of using UI components in application development lies in their ability to improve reusability and significantly reduce development time. UI components are modular in nature, which means they can be created once and reused across different parts of an application or even across different projects. This modularity allows developers to maintain consistency in design and functionality while also accelerating the development process since they can quickly assemble applications using pre-built components rather than starting from scratch each time. By leveraging a library of reusable components, developers can focus more on the unique aspects of their applications, leading to faster iterations and deployment. This approach not only streamlines the development workflow but also makes it easier to update and maintain applications over time, as changes made to a single component can automatically propagate throughout all instances where that component is utilized. While custom styling, compliance, and security are important aspects of application development, they do not encompass the overarching advantage provided by the use of UI components, which is fundamentally about efficiency and reusability.

The primary benefit of using UI components in application development lies in their ability to improve reusability and significantly reduce development time. UI components are modular in nature, which means they can be created once and reused across different parts of an application or even across different projects. This modularity allows developers to maintain consistency in design and functionality while also accelerating the development process since they can quickly assemble applications using pre-built components rather than starting from scratch each time.

By leveraging a library of reusable components, developers can focus more on the unique aspects of their applications, leading to faster iterations and deployment. This approach not only streamlines the development workflow but also makes it easier to update and maintain applications over time, as changes made to a single component can automatically propagate throughout all instances where that component is utilized.

While custom styling, compliance, and security are important aspects of application development, they do not encompass the overarching advantage provided by the use of UI components, which is fundamentally about efficiency and reusability.

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y